《syrinxes》是什么意思
潘神销,(鸟的)鸣管,耳管( syrinx的名词复数 );
英英释义
syrinx[ 'siriŋks ]
- n.
- a primitive wind instrument consisting of several parallel pipes bound together
同义词:panpipepandean pipe
- the vocal organ of a bird
- a primitive wind instrument consisting of several parallel pipes bound together
